MILWAUKEE (CBS 58) -- Milwaukee's fire chief is in the running for another job. Chief Mark Rohlfing is one of six finalists being considered to lead the fire department in Austin, Texas.
The Austin States Man reported the list of finalists Wednesday evening which includes people from Atlanta, San Antonio, Laredo, Virginia and Phoenix.
Chief Rohlfing will take part in panel interviews starting next week. He has been with Milwaukee Fire since 2010.
